'''''Mappy''''' ({{ja|マッピー|Mappī}}, ''Mappy'') is a series of platform games starring the titular policemouse Mappy as he retrieves stolen goods from the cat burglar Goro and his goons, the Mewkies. The game's trampoline serves as the basis for [[Pac-Jump]], and the titular Mappy cameos in Namco Roulette. ''Mappy''{{'}}s main theme and level complete theme appear in ''{{SSB4MusicLink|Namco|Namco Arcade '80s Retro Medley 1}}'', and ''Ultimate'' includes a remix of the game's music, ''{{SSBUMusicLink|Pac-Man|Mappy Medley}}''.
